How to fill out minutes of form regular

Illustration

How to fill out Minutes of the Regular Meeting of the New York State Bridge Authority

01
Start with the heading: Include the title 'Minutes of the Regular Meeting of the New York State Bridge Authority' at the top.
02
Date and Time: Write the date and time when the meeting took place.
03
Location: Specify the location of the meeting.
04
Attendance: List the names of attendees, including board members and staff, and indicate who was absent.
05
Call to Order: Note the time the meeting was called to order by the chairperson.
06
Approval of Previous Minutes: Record any discussions regarding the approval of the minutes from the previous meeting.
07
Agenda Items: Document the key discussion points, decisions made, and any actions to be taken under specific agenda items.
08
Public Comments: Include any comments or questions from the public attendees.
09
Next Meeting: State the date, time, and location of the next meeting if known.
10
Adjournment: Record the time when the meeting was adjourned.

Robert's Rules (Section 48:1-16) state that “the minutes should contain mainly a record of what was done at the meeting, not what was said by the members.” Minutes are not transcripts of meetings; rather, the document contains a record of actions taken by the body, organized by the meeting's order of business (agenda).
What To Include In Meeting Minutes The meeting agenda. First and last names of attendees. The date and time of the meeting. Any formal announcements and/or important decisions made. Details of attendance, including who joined late or left early. Projects assigned, who is responsible for them and the deadlines.
What Are Meeting Minutes? Meeting minutes are the written record of what was discussed and decided during a meeting. They typically include the date and time of the meeting, a list of attendees, a summary of the topics discussed, decisions made, action items assigned, and the time of adjournment.
The format of the minutes should closely follow the format of the agenda. It's easier to record the minutes if the meeting follows the agenda. The minutes are generally taken down at the meeting in a rough format then later written or typed properly and fully, unless the meeting has been recorded.
Meeting minutes are an official written record of a meeting, encapsulating discussions, decisions, task assignments, and deadlines. These notes are not only a tool for accountability, indicating task assignments, but also serve as a reliable reference for decisions, preventing future misunderstandings.
